Output 889e439de6d4b32622fd206f608b54bd6111e271286798578cb7163cb4c10926:8

value
272000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 64787fb6bd8a12e92218f353f474d2c40afdaeb0 OP_EQUALVERIFY OP_CHECKSIG
address
1AAEvbLzuhGipaKQffHar2UVer2Z2XbYRS
transaction
889e439de6d4b32622fd206f608b54bd6111e271286798578cb7163cb4c10926
spent
true